This 3-day Tanzania safari to Nyerere National Park (Selous) offers one of the most authentic and untouched wilderness experiences in Africa. Formerly known as Selous Game Reserve, this vast UNESCO World Heritage Site is home to some of the largest populations of elephants, hippos, lions, wild dogs, and crocodiles in East Africa. With its mix of open plains, woodlands, lakes, and the mighty Rufiji River, Nyerere NP gives you a perfect blend of game drives, boat safaris, and walking adventures.

Day 1: Dar es Salaam - Nyerere National Park + Evening Game Drive

Your journey begins early in the morning as you drive from Dar es Salaam to Nyerere National Park. The scenic drive takes about 5–6 hours and passes through small villages, palm trees, and beautiful landscapes. Upon arrival at the park, you will check in at your lodge or tented camp, where you will be welcomed with lunch and a short rest.

In the late afternoon, you will go for your first evening game drive inside Nyerere National Park. This is the perfect time to spot elephants, giraffes, zebras, impalas, and lions preparing for their evening hunt. You may also see the rare African wild dogs, which are one of the highlights of Selous.

Return to your lodge for dinner and a relaxing night by the campfire, surrounded by the sounds of nature.

After an early breakfast, you will begin a full-day game drive in the vast and untouched wilderness of Nyerere National Park. The park is huge—bigger than Switzerland—so every game drive feels new and exciting. You will explore different habitats, including open plains, thick forests, and the famous Rufiji River ecosystem.

Animals often seen include elephants, lions, buffaloes, wildebeests, zebras, hippos, crocodiles, elands, hartebeests, and many bird species. Selous is also known for having one of the highest concentrations of wild dogs, so keep your camera ready.

You will stop for a packed lunch at a scenic picnic spot inside the park, enjoying the fresh air and peaceful environment. After lunch, continue with your game drive until late afternoon before returning to the lodge.

Relax at the lodge, enjoy sunset views, and have a delicious dinner before another peaceful night in the African wilderness.

This morning you will enjoy one of the most exciting activities in Selous—an early morning boat safari on the Rufiji River. This river is the lifeline of the park and attracts hundreds of animals every day. From your boat, you will see hippos swimming, crocodiles sunbathing, and elephants drinking along the riverbank. You will also spot many colorful birds flying over the water and resting on the trees.

The boat safari gives you a close and safe way to enjoy wildlife from a completely different angle—an experience you won’t find in many other parks in Tanzania.

After the boat safari, you will return to the lodge for breakfast, check out, and begin your drive back to Dar es Salaam, arriving in the late afternoon.
